Emergent constraints package to reproduce figures in Simpson et al (2021)

This package contains the scripts necessary to (a) pre-process data and (b) perform the analysis that is described in Simpson et al (2021) Emergent constraints on the large scale atmospheric circulation and regional hydroclimate: do they still work in CMIP6 and how much can they actually constrain the future Submitted to J. Clim

In the following, it is assumed that this package has been downloaded to $DIR.

Installing utilities

To install the utilities (located in ecpaper_utils) that are required for performing the analysis in the jupyter notebooks to process data and generate figures

cd $DIR
pip install -e . --user

DATA pre-processing

All the fields used for the analysis have been pre-processed and will be provided in netcdf format upon publication of the manuscript.

The scripts used to process the data are found in $DIR/DATASORT

Three sub-directories contain processing scripts for each of the emergent constraints considered

$DIR/DATASORT/JLAT
$DIR/DATASORT/VWIND
$DIR/DATASORT/CALP

CMIP5, CMIP6 and observational data are read and processed from a local archive in the Climate and Global Dynamics Laboratory at NCAR. If a user wishes to start the data processing from scratch, they will have to change the file paths to point to the relevant location in their archives.

The multi-model large ensemble data were read and processed from the USClivar Multi-Model Large Ensembles archived on the cheyenne supercomputer at /glade/collections/cdg/data/CLIVAR-LE or availabale through the NCAR Climate Data Gateway (see cesm.ucar.edu/projects/community-projects/MMLEA/).

Processed data are provided within sub-directories for each emergent constraint and are used in the codes provided in $DIR/ANALYSIS

Analysis and figure generation

The jupyter notebooks that were used to generate the figures in the main text are located in

$DIR/FIGURE_SCRIPTS

and scripts to make the supplementary figures are located in

$DIR/SUPP_FIGURE_SCIPTS
